Quality cues to look for

Quality assessment in vintage apparel hinges on fabric integrity, stitching, and fit. Check seams for loose threads, confirm zippers operate smoothly, and inspect prints or logos for fading that affects character rather than detracts from it. Pay attention to sizing differences, as Vintage Jacket modern fits often diverge from past standards. If possible, request measurements and compare them to your best-fitting garments. A well-preserved piece should feel substantial, with weight to its fabric and clear detailing that reflects its era.

Styling tips for everyday wear

When integrating mid-century or late-20th-century pieces into modern outfits, balance is key. Pair a structured jacket with clean denim and simple sneakers to anchor the look. Layering works well with vintage fabrics when you choose muted tones that echo contemporary palettes. Consider tailoring or alterations to achieve a flattering silhouette while preserving the garment’s original charm. Accessories should remain understated to keep the focus on the cut and texture that define vintage aesthetics.

Shopping smart and safely

Smart shopping involves researching reputable sellers, verifying authenticity, and asking detailed questions about condition and provenance. Look for clear photographs, close-ups of badges and labels, and a transparent return policy. Budget wisely by setting limits for pieces that meet your criteria and resisting impulse buys that offer little long-term value. A methodical approach reduces risk and helps you build a cohesive, sustainable collection over time.
